Henrik Lundqvist and the Rangers handled the challenge of facing one of the league’s top teams. Mats Zuccarello scored a third-period goal and Lundqvist made 31 saves in the New York Rangers’ 2-1 victory over the Washington Capitals on Sunday. Ryan McDonagh scored in the first period for New York, which has won seven of eight overall and five in a row at home.
